Background The film is an adaptation of the 1944 book of the same name, said to be dictated by the spirit André Luiz and
psychographed by
Chico Xavier, Brazil's best-known and respected medium, having channeled more than 400 books. The book is considered a great classic of
spiritist literature. Engaging the reader from a first-person narrative, André Luiz delivers his impressions of the spirit world he encounters after his death. Detailed drawings of the city "Our Home" as well as the architecture of the buildings, ministries and homes, were created by the medium Heigorina Cunha through her observations made during her alleged travels outside of the body in March 1979, led and guided by the spirit Lucius. These drawings served as inspiration to create the visual architecture of the city depicted in the movie. Her drawings have been clarified and confirmed by Chico Xavier to correspond to the spiritual city of Rio de Janeiro called "Our Home".
Visual effects Nosso Lar is rich in special effects. The majority of the movie takes place in this spiritual city, which is famous in the Spiritist movement. Many spiritists and spiritualists waited anxiously for the release of the film that recorded the second highest debut of a Brazilian film since the rebirth of Brazilian cinema in the 1990s, after
Elite Squad: The Enemy Within, released one month later. For photography and special effects, international professionals were invited, including director of photography
Ueli Steiger (from
10,000 BC and
The Day After Tomorrow), special effects supervisor
Lev Kolobov and the Canadian firm
Intelligent Creatures (
The Hunting Party,
Babel, and
Watchmen). ==References==
